Xbox 360 - Game of the Year |
Ó
Best 360 Game: Gears of War 2
Runner's Up: Fable 2, Left 4 Dead
Comments: GoW2 is everything GoW was, only bigger, better, and damn - the Lancer still takes the damn cake. Wish I could say Left 4 Dead was better (I'm a zombie fan, so there!), but it's still GoW2, hands down.
Isaac C:
Best 360 Game: Grand Theft Auto IV
Runner's Up: Bully: Scholarship Edition, Ninja Gaiden II
Comments: Two words. Downloadable content.
Mabie A:
Best 360 Game: Gears of War 2
Runner's Up: Fallout 3, Fable 2
Karl B:
Best 360 Game: Gears of War 2
Runner's Up: Left 4 Dead, Fable 2
Comments: Gears of War 2 - One word, folks: Horde!
Left 4 Dead - Left 4 Dead is the first and last word in co-op shooters. The fact that it so perfectly captures the feel of a zombie movie is an added bonus.
Fable 2 - The amount of things you can do in this game is just sick. The good kind of sick, that is.
Glenn M:
Best 360 Game: Left 4 Dead
Runner's Up: Gears of War 2, Fable II
Comments: - It's dawn of the not-so-dead with the adrenaline jolt of being swarmed by fast-moving zombies.. fun to play alone, hilarious when you've got friends over. They can all talk about gears of war all they want, but that game didn't even excel its predecessor... it's a great game, but it won't be my #1 Xbox 360 title...
Fable II puts the role in role-playing game.. character morphing, responsive environments, and allowing the player to play a more active role in how events unfold is a very welcome concept.. unfortunately, the stiff graphics that fall out of place in Xbox 360 pull it down hard..
Chris C:
Best 360 Game: Fallout 3
Runner's Up: Burnout Paradise, Gears of War II
Comments: Those of you who've been around long enough might remember a little rant I went on a few years back bemoaning the lack of evolution in the modern RPG. It goes to show you just how much I respect the work put into Fallout 3 by the folks at Bethesda. You can't ignore the game's faults, and there are many, but the sheer amount of content, freedom of choice, the fact that there truly are repercussions for your actions makes this my absolute favorite game of the year.
